Art School Confidential (comics) " Art School Confidential " is a four-page black-and-white comic by Daniel Clowes. This 10-digit number is your confirmation number. credits. 1917. It originally appeared in issue #7 (November 1991) of Clowes' comic book Eightball and was later reprinted in the book collections Orgy Bound and Twentieth Century Eightball.
